#4ef1b8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ef1b8 is composed of 30.6% red, 94.5%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.7%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 159 degrees, a saturation of 85.3% and a lightness of 62.5%. #4ef1b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ffff with #00e371.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#4ef1b8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ef1b8 has RGB values of R:78, G:241,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 5173688.
